Chocolate-Sap
aka Gorilla Sap
Chocolate-Sap, aka Gorilla Sap, is a 70% Sativa hybrid from Taste Budz crossing Citrus Sap and Chocolate Diesel. Packing a punchy 27% THC, it delivers an uplifting, talkative, euphoric high balanced by a relaxed, sleepy undertone. Expect a dessert-meets-diesel flavor profile of sweet chocolate, citrus, pine, and skunky notes — a versatile hybrid for social sessions or unwinding.

Terpenes are the aromatic compounds that shape the character of a high. The blend a strain carries — not its THC percentage — is what makes one feel bright and social and another heavy and sleepy, which is why the top three are listed rather than just the leader.
Terpene percentages belong to the jar, not the strain. They move with harvest timing, drying, cure and shelf age — the lighter ones literally evaporate. What holds steady is which terpenes lead, so that is what we rank.

THC% tells you how strong. Terpenes tell you how it feels.
THC percentage is a property of the product in your hand, not of the strain. It shifts with the batch, the grower, the harvest, and how the flower was cured and stored — the same strain can test several points apart from two different jars.
Treat the ranges below as market context for what to expect on a shelf — then read the actual label on the product you are buying, and use the terpene profile to judge how it will feel.

Chocolate-Sap: A Sweet, Talkative Sativa-Leaning Hybrid
Chocolate-Sap (also known as Gorilla Sap) is a 70% Sativa / 30% Indica hybrid that pairs a punchy 27% THC potency with a dessert-like chocolate-citrus profile. Bred by Taste Budz, this strain has built a reputation among enthusiasts for combining an energetic, chatty head high with just enough body ease to keep things comfortable.
🧬 Genetic Heritage & Lineage
Chocolate-Sap is a cross between Citrus Sap and Chocolate Diesel, two flavor-forward parents that pass along their signature notes. The Chocolate Diesel side contributes the strain's cocoa-and-fuel character, while Citrus Sap brightens things up with a citrus edge. Taste Budz, the breeder behind this cross, is known for prioritizing flavor-driven genetics, and that focus is evident here.
Aroma Profile
Expect a layered nose on this one: sweet chocolate and earthy tones sit up front, followed by pine, citrus, and herbal undertones, with a skunky, chemical diesel edge lingering underneath. It's a strain that smells like dessert met a fuel pump — unusual, but distinctive.
👅 Flavor Experience
On the exhale, Chocolate-Sap delivers a similar chocolate-forward taste, sweetened with citrus and rounded out by earthy and skunky notes. The flavor journey mirrors the aroma closely, making this a strain where what you smell is largely what you taste.
🎯 Effects & Experience
Users commonly report a mix of euphoric, happy, uplifted, energetic, and talkative effects, making Chocolate-Sap a social, conversation-friendly choice. As the high settles in, many also note a relaxed and even sleepy undertone, giving it a somewhat unpredictable but generally pleasant arc — energized and chatty at first, with the option to mellow out later depending on dose and setting.
